I tried to fly my P4P+ in 18miles/hour wind and to take some photos (short distance <500m, altitude <50m), I found the gimbal could not move at all. It kept in downward position. Then I took the drone home and re-calibrated the gimbal and IMU, everything was fine. I flied at home, gimbal showed normal.


Does anyone see the similar situation?
What's the reason?


Thanks!
 
Ground winds might have been that......But winds at altitude are much much more....them tiny gimbal motors maybe could not move the camera because of the higher winds Up in the air....thats my 2 cents worth ! i'm positive others have ideas too as why.
 
When you took off, was the gimbal in the correct position? I only ask as I have had a few power ups where the gimbal goes through it's dance, but then ends up pointing down or off. When this happens, I will power cycle the power not the P4 and on the 2nd attempt, the gimbal will position the camera correctly.
